| Title: | Parties and Partisanship: A Brief Introduction |
| Author: | Geer, John Gray |
| Abstract: | The article is an introduction to ten essays which will comprise a three-part special issue of the periodical Political Behavior. The essays are about partisanship in American politics. Geer summarizes the essays' topics and also dedicates the special issue to political scientist Warren Miller, whose contributions he discusses. The essays are revised versions of papers presented at a conference held at Vanderbilt in Oct. 2001. |
| Description: | Originally published in Political Behavior, v. 24, no. 2 (2002), p. 85-91. |
